Abstract:

The original strain C. cohnii ATCC 30772 was irradiated by 60Co-γ ray. Mutant 2.4k-2A2-5 was selected as a
desired positive mutant according to its growth and development, Sudan black B staining, biomass, oil content and DHA
content, following screening and rescreening. The average DHA production was 39.04%, which was 3.39% higher than the
original strain. The yield and content of oil produced by this mutant was 51.66% and 63.37%, respectively, which were also
higher than those by the original strain. The DHA yield (measured in 7.14 g/L fermented liquid) was increased by 56.92%
compared to that produced by the original strain.
